man pages section 1: User Commands

Exit Print View

Updated: July 2014
 
 

eqn2graph (1)

Name

eqn2graph - convert an EQN equation into a cropped image

Synopsis

eqn2graph [ -unsafe ] [ -format fmt ]

Description




User Commands                                        EQN2GRAPH(1)



NAME
     eqn2graph - convert an EQN equation into a cropped image

SYNOPSIS
     eqn2graph [ -unsafe ] [ -format fmt ]

DESCRIPTION
     Reads an EQN equation (one line) as input; produces an image
     file (by default in Portable Network Graphics format)  suit-
     able for the Web as output.

     Your  input  EQN  code  should not have the .EQ/.EN preamble
     that that normally precedes it within groff(1)  macros;  nor
     do  you  need to have dollar-sign or other delimiters around
     the equation.

     The output image will be a black-on-white graphic clipped to
     the  smallest  possible  bounding  box that contains all the
     black pixels.  By  specifying  command-line  options  to  be
     passed to convert(1) you can give it a border, set the back-
     ground transparent, set the image's pixel density,  or  per-
     form other useful transformations.

     This  program  uses  geqn(1),  groff(1), and the ImageMagick
     convert(1) program.  These programs  must  be  installed  on
     your  system  and  accessible on your $PATH for eqn2graph to
     work.

OPTIONS
     -unsafe
          Run groff(1) in the  `unsafe'  mode  enabling  the  PIC
          macro sh to execute arbitrary commands.  The default is
          to forbid this.

     -format fmt
          Specify an output format; the default is PNG  (Portable
          Network Graphics).  Any format that convert(1) can emit
          is supported.

     Command-line switches and arguments  not  listed  above  are
     passed to convert(1).

FILES
     /usr/share/groff/1.19.2/tmac/eqnrc
          The geqn(1) initialization file.

ENVIRONMENT
     GROFF_TMPDIR
          The directory in which temporary files will be created.
          If this is not set eqn2graph searches  the  environment
          variables  TMPDIR, TMP, and TEMP (in that order).  Oth-
          erwise, temporary files will be created in /tmp.



Groff Version 1.19.Last change: 27 October 2003                 1






User Commands                                        EQN2GRAPH(1)



ATTRIBUTES
     See  attributes(5)  for  descriptions   of   the   following
     attributes:

     +---------------+------------------+
     |ATTRIBUTE TYPE | ATTRIBUTE VALUE  |
     +---------------+------------------+
     |Availability   | text/groff       |
     +---------------+------------------+
     |Stability      | Uncommitted      |
     +---------------+------------------+
SEE ALSO
     pic2graph(1),  grap2graph(1), geqn(1), groff(1), gs(1), con-
     vert(1).

AUTHOR
     Eric S. Raymond <esr@thyrsus.com>.



NOTES
     This  software  was   built   from   source   available   at
     https://java.net/projects/solaris-userland.    The  original
     community       source       was       downloaded       from
     http://ftp.gnu.org/gnu/groff/groff-1.19.2.tar.gz

     Further  information about this software can be found on the
     open source community  website  at  http://www.gnu.org/soft-
     ware/groff/.


























Groff Version 1.19.Last change: 27 October 2003                 2